Diagnosis
Adult ADHD is a condition which can help you if you feel like your relationships, work, and school are falling apart. Although it can seem like a huge issue, it can be a way to take control of your life and get the assistance you need.
A health care professional is able to determine the ADHD diagnosis based upon a thorough medical and psychiatric history and current symptoms that match or exceed the diagnostic criteria for this disorder. The doctor should also assess the patient's capability to perform normal functioning in multiple spheres, such as at home, at school, at work, and social interactions.
To diagnose an individual, the doctor will use the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ders Fifth Edition (DSM-5) to determine the symptoms. These symptoms include inattention and hyperactivity.
The person should also have had at least one of these symptoms prior to the age of 12 years old. They should have caused problems in more than one sphere.
Many adults struggle to recall their childhood experiences So they need to be interviewed by a specialist who is familiar with their family history. This could include their parents, siblings or close friends.
It is essential that the patient be honest about their symptoms and how they impact their daily lives. You might not be able to get a specialist to accurately evaluate your symptoms and give you an appropriate diagnosis.
In the course of the examination the doctor will require you to fill out a questionnaire called the ASRS-v1.1. It will ask you to describe your symptoms, how they impact your life and what treatment you have tried to treat them.
If a specialist believes you have the potential to suffer from adult ADHD They may suggest further testing. A computer-based test can be used to determine your ability to concentrate and manage your impulses. They can also look for other conditions that could be contributing to your symptoms like anxiety or depression.
In addition to the physical tests A specialist will also conduct a lengthy interview with you to gather more details about your conditions and how they impact your daily life. They will also review your school records , and adhd Tests online meet with those who know you as a child such as your teachers and parents.
Treatment
Talk to your doctor if you have been diagnosed as having ADHD. There are many treatments and medications that can help control your ADHD symptoms.
You may have to try different combinations of medications based on your age before you discover the best one. It is also important to understand that you will need to be prepared to change your behavior and lifestyle to make the best use of these treatments.
Your doctor can assist you to find a reputable ADHD specialist. He or she will ask you about any symptoms you have and any issues they've caused like problems at work, school or in relationships.
Your doctor will also run various tests to evaluate your condition, including symptoms checklists and attention-span tests. These tests are designed to assess the way you respond to stimuli, and evaluate your results against others who have typical attention responses.
In addition the doctor will conduct a thorough medical history, including any problems you've faced at home or work, alcohol or drug use, and relationships with family members and your friends. Your doctor may also refer you to a psychiatrist or psychologist to conduct a thorough psychiatric examination.
Once you've been diagnosed with ADHD, you can start treatment with a psychiatrist and psychologist. These mental health professionals are able to prescribe medication and prescribe treatments to aid you in managing your ADHD symptoms and improve your overall quality of life and reduce the negative effects that ADHD has on your life.
You could also try a range of calming techniques like yoga and meditation. These therapies can increase your concentration, reduce impulsivity, and reduce anxiety.
Some people benefit from cognitive behavior therapy, which helps you learn to manage ADHD and improve overall quality. Family therapy and marriage can help you and your spouse improve communication, conflict resolution, and problem-solving capabilities.
